I'm sure that Windows Vista did get quite a few people to switch to MACs, and they may not be coming back. But my guess is that those that explored other OSes like Linux will probably switch to Windows 7 because of how insanely easy it is to set up.
MAC has always had the advantage of building all the hardware (or at least setting the standards) that the user might hook up and certifying the software. So they could pretty much guarantee compatibility in any configuration. Most Windows problems come from the user building some crazy mix of hardware that the Win designers never considered, and then using software from 50 different sources. The monster database of drivers that Windows 7 has built in, plus its compatibility manager, takes away some of MAC's advantage without restricting the owner from using whatever odd setup he wants.
